It is one of the most fascinating buildings in Istanbul. It is the only mosque in the world with 6 minarets. Only sultans and their families could build mosques with multiple minarets. Previously, there was a mosque in Mecca with 6 minarets. When this was done, the 7th minaret was added to the mosque in Mecca by Ahmet I.
Sultanahmet Mosque was built by Ahmet I in 1606/ 1616 on the historical peninsula in Istanbul, opposite Hagia Sophia, to architect Sedefkar Mehmet Aga. Architect Mehmet Aga was the chief architect of the palace, which was raised by Mimar Sinan.
1. Ahmet was 14 years old when he ascended the throne as the 14th Ottoman sultan and died 14 years later at the age of 28. This mosque made a lot of mention of its name with the tiles inside it. It has an inner light that is not in any shrine. There is a very large complex in the mosque. Only the mausoleum and madrasah remained from the complex buildings that disappeared over time. 1.Ahmet, his wife Kösem Sultan, sons 4.Murat and Osman the Younger, as well as many relatives are in the shrine. To the north of the mosque is the Hünkar Pavilion, where the sultan spends pre-prayer time. 1. Ahmet has taken an important place in history by removing the right of sultans to kill their brothers. According to his law, the oldest of the dynasty began to ascend to the throne, and an inhumane act such as brotherly murder came to an end. 1. Ahmet built this mosque not with the spoils of war, but with the money taken from the treasury of the Ottoman Empire. Mosques used to be built with war loot all the time. Sultanahmet Mosque with a unique Ottoman architectural texture; it is visited by thousands of tourists every year.
